Job Hive is a web application that aggregates all job listings from multiple sources such as Google, LinkedIn, Indeed, and Reed in one place, to help job seekers find employment opportunities easier and succeed in their job search. The application was created using React, Node.js, Tailwind, Yup, Formik, and Email.js, and it has been deployed on Netlify.
As a developer, you can install this app by cloning the GitHub repository to your local computer. Copy the HTTPS link found under the “code” tab. Open Git Bash and run the command “git clone” then pasting the GitHub link. Run the command “code .” to open the files in VS Code.
git clone <repository link>
code .
Open Job Hive in Integrated Terminal and install all dependencies by running the following command:
npm i
You can then test the app by running the command:
npm start
